My mate used Smart Drive out on the Ban Nong Sai road. He had a current UK license, no IDP & on a visa exempt entry. He was picked up at the hotel, driven to Non Sung getting a medical certificate on the way. He then had to do the same as us mere mortals in the DLT. Finally driven back to his hotel. I forget how much, maybe ฿6000 to ฿7000. Seemed a lot to me for a glorified taxi service.
